Lot 712 | JAKE AND DINOS CHAPMAN (B. 1966 & B. 1962)
Estimate value
£ 10 000 – 15 000
Doggy
fibreglass, painted resin, wigs and trainers
31 1⁄2 x 25 5⁄8 x 15 3⁄4in. (80 x 65 x 58cm.)
Executed in 1997
Provenance
Victoria Miro, London.
Acquired from the above by the present owner in 1997.
Exhibited
New York, P.S.1 Contemporary Art Centre, P.S.1 Reopening, 1997-1998.
New York, The Flag Art Foundation, Disturbing Innocence Curated by Eric Fischl, 2014-2015.
